Arflinafurgga
Arflinafurgga is a pass in Arosa, Plessur, Graubünden and has an elevation of 2,247 metres. Arflinafurgga is situated nearby to the village Peist, as well as near the hamlet Strassberg.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Peist
Village
Photo: Parpan05,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Peist is a former municipality in the district of Plessur in the canton of Graubünden in Switzerland. On 1 January 2013 the former municipalities of Peist, Calfreisen, Castiel, Langwies, Lüen, Molinis and St. Peter-Pagig merged into the municipality of Arosa.
